Melbourne, To-day.

The Prime Minister, Mr. R. G. Menzies has announced that. Mr. R. G. Casey, Minister of Supply and Development, is proceeding to London before Christmas for the conference of Dominions and Ca- binet Ministers-Reuter.

Washington.

COMMERCE DEPARTMENT officials cannot see where Germany can draw heavily on abundant Russia for

war materials.

Reasons given are:

1. Germany hasn't the money to pay for them. 2. Russia does not have much surplus export. 3. Germany, even in peace times, could not make machinery deliveries, Russia's main need, on time.

SEVERAL DIFFICULTIES Even in peace times the above fac- tors steadily choked off trade between Germany and Russia. Germany lately made an effort to revive it by offering Russia a 200,000,000 mark credit. Russia agreed to take it out in ma- chinery and pay back over a seven- year period. In turn, Germany was to buy a corresponding amount of Rus- sian goods it needed.

But even if the agreement is carried out promptly and the exchange of goods effected, 200,000,000 marks is only about $80,000,000, a trifling su in International trade.

The difficulty lies in several direc- tions. Russia already has bought ex- tensively of German machinery during the past 12 years.

She has bought whole factories at a time. The first five-year plan in Russia was largely implemented by German machinery.

But machinery breeds machinery and in time Russia began to supply her own needs with- machinery she had bought. So her purchases fell off. For instance, în 1931 Russia bought $211,- 318,000 worth of German goods, pri- marfly textile mills, electrical and metallurgical plants, sugar and flour mills.
